Research Policy and Review 17. Some Applications of Supercomputers in Urban and Regional Analysis and Modelling

Abstract:
In a recent article, Harris explored the use of supercomputers in urban and regional modelling. Some of the suggestions he made are qualified and some areas outlined where existing supercomputers could be used with immediate success rather than at some indefinite future date.
